Pokémon Showdown Client

This is a repository for some of the client code for Pokémon Showdown.

This is what runs play.pokemonshowdown.com.

WARNING: You probably want the Pokémon Showdown server.

Testing

You can make and test client changes simply by opening testclient.html. This will allow you to test changes to the client without setting up your own login server.

You can connect to an arbitrary server by navigating to testclient.html?~~host:port. For example, to connect to a server running locally on port 8000, you can navigate to testclient.html?~~localhost:8000.

Certain things will fail:

  • Registering
  • Changing name to a registered name other than the one you are currently logged in with (however, changing to an unregistered name will work, and you can even change back to your original registered name afterward)
  • The ladder tab
  • The /ladder command

Everything else can be tested, though.

Warning

This repository is not "batteries included". It does NOT include everything necessary to run a full Pokémon Showdown client.

In particular, it doesn't include a login/authentication server, nor does it include the database abstraction library used by the ladder library (although it's similar enough to mysqli that you can use that with minimal changes).

It also doesn't include several resource files (namely, the /audio/ and /sprites/ directories) for size reasons.

In other words, this repository is incomplete and NOT intended for people who wish to serve their own Pokémon Showdown client (you can, but it'll require you to rewrite some things). Rather, it's intended for people who wish to contribute and submit pull requests to Pokémon Showdown's client.

License

Pokémon Showdown's client is distributed under the terms of the AGPLv3.

WARNING: This is NOT the same license as Pokémon Showdown's server.
